About

Serenay Elgün is a scholar working on Physiology, Periodontics and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Serenay Elgün has authored 40 papers receiving a total of 645 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Physiology, 10 papers in Periodontics and 6 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Serenay Elgün's work include Oral microbiology and periodontitis research (10 papers), Nitric Oxide and Endothelin Effects (6 papers) and Peptidase Inhibition and Analysis (5 papers). Serenay Elgün is often cited by papers focused on Oral microbiology and periodontitis research (10 papers), Nitric Oxide and Endothelin Effects (6 papers) and Peptidase Inhibition and Analysis (5 papers). Serenay Elgün collaborates with scholars based in Türkiye, United States and Switzerland. Serenay Elgün's co-authors include Nurdan Özmeriç, Hakan Kumbasar, İlker Durak, Serdar Öztürk, İlker Durak, Murat Kaçmaz, Burcu Özdemir, Hanefi Özbek, İmge Ergüder and Pınar Atasoy and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Journal Of Clinical Periodontology and Journal of Periodontology.
